diff options
author | Alan Modra <amodra@gmail.com> | 2016-05-03 22:08:32 +0930 |
---|---|---|
committer | Alan Modra <amodra@gcc.gnu.org> | 2016-05-03 22:08:32 +0930 |
commit | 71aca5a07a0b9646d5040577ab646c3d147fb228 (patch) | |
tree | 69984171a68d8edd62593607cdf9695a1f0c37d0 /libada | |
parent | 2fd70ec11c4e3661dc4313729cb1a76b1733e79e (diff) | |
download | gcc-71aca5a07a0b9646d5040577ab646c3d147fb228.zip gcc-71aca5a07a0b9646d5040577ab646c3d147fb228.tar.gz gcc-71aca5a07a0b9646d5040577ab646c3d147fb228.tar.bz2 |
[RS6000] Fix ICE caused by rs6000_savres_strategy thinko
rev 235672 (git cffc0b35) changed the condition for SAVE_MULTIPLE/
STORE_MULTIPLE, wrongly allowing a single reg.
gcc/
* config/rs6000/rs6000.c (rs6000_savres_strategy): Correct condition
for SAVE_MULTIPLE/STORE_MULTIPLE.
gcc/testsuite/
* gcc.target/powerpc/savres.c: Add func using a single gpr.
From-SVN: r235820
Diffstat (limited to 'libada')
0 files changed, 0 insertions, 0 deletions